Facebook Chat exploit discovered

Facebook Chat exploit discovered

If your “Facebook chat is down for maintenance at this time”, there’s a good reason for that. A YouTube user dubbed Attwood66 discovered a really simply exploit that blatantly discloses the content of the Facebook Chat sessions of your friends, , as well as any pending friend requests!

Amazon Kindle adds Facebook support

Amazon Kindle adds Facebook support

If you regularly read books and magazines on an Amazon Kindle, you’ll probably be interested to know that the next software update will add the option to share book passages and quotes with friends on Facebook and Twitter, directly from your Kindle.
